"Braiding Sweetgrass" is a human action symbolic of community- with all of life. The whole book is about that.

“Braiding Sweetgrass” by Robin Wall Kimmerer. It’s all about our personal relationship to nature. We share the world with the rest of nature. All of nature, including the non-human manifestations of life, was here before us. We are new partners. The rest are our brothers and sisters who sustain us and we must sustain them in reciprocity and gratitude. The author is a plant scientist and university professor who found that her native American heritage provides, through tradition, culture and practical ways of living, the right approach for sustaining the world. Thankfulness for what we have will come to people easily if we have a more personal relationship to the other ‘persons’ of our planet. Gratitude is natural. Read the book!Read full review...
